Celebrating Excellence in Family Law at MKFM Law



Mirabella, Kincaid, Frederick & Mirabella, LLC has once again made headlines with its outstanding legal experts being recognized as 2025 Super Lawyers across the state of Illinois. This prestigious accolade, which marks a significant achievement in the legal community, highlights the firm’s dedication to providing exceptional legal services to its clients, especially in the realm of family law.

Among those recognized is George S. Frederick, the managing partner of MKFM Law. Attorney Frederick has been an influential figure in the legal landscape for over a decade, earning the Super Lawyer title for an impressive 11 consecutive years. His expertise lies in addressing employment law matters, including wrongful termination, sexual harassment, and any disputes related to non-compete agreements. Additionally, he represents clients in family law cases, including divorce, child custody, and spousal maintenance.

Lynn M. Mirabella, another esteemed attorney at MKFM Law, has also been named a Super Lawyer for her significant contributions to family law in Illinois since 2012. Her passion for advocating for children in custody disputes and her skills in high-net-worth divorce cases have distinguished her in the field. As a certified Guardian ad Litem and a Child’s Representative, she has made a lasting impact on the lives of many families.

A Legacy of Dedication



Henry D. Kass has made his mark in the legal sphere by being recognized as a Super Lawyer for ten consecutive years. With a strong foundation in family and collaborative law, Kass has been an asset to MKFM Law's roster. Eligibility to practice law in both Illinois and Iowa, coupled with his dedication to pro bono work, showcases his commitment to serving his community.

Joshua D. Bedwell, who has been with MKFM Law for over a decade, was named a Super Lawyer after previously being recognized as a Rising Star. His ability to navigate contentious family law cases, from divorces to child custody battles, has made him an integral part of the team.

Another notable mention is Lindsay C. Stella, a partner at MKFM Law who has also earned the Super Lawyer designation in 2025. Stella’s relentless advocacy for her clients and her expertise in drafting prenuptial and postnuptial agreements have contributed significantly to the firm’s accolades. Her involvement in various legal associations, including the DuPage Association of Women Lawyers, reflects her commitment to advancing the legal community.

Stacey A. McCullough and Todd D. Scalzo are additional Super Lawyers from MKFM Law, both of whom have been recognized since 2019. Their continuous contributions to family law solidify the firm’s reputation as a leader in legal representation.

MKFM Law has also nurtured a rising talent pool with several attorneys receiving the Rising Stars designation, including Megan C. Harris, Britni L. Bartik, and Lacey K. Boulware, among others.
